The community was shocked and saddened by the sudden death of Mr. Dave SUPPLE Monday morning. He had appeared to be as well as usual that morning and had even made a trip to town. After he returned home he spoke of feeling badly and within a few minutes passed away. Mr. Supple has lived in Scranton many years and has a host of friends who are grieved at this death and extend sincere sympathy to the family. Funeral services were held this morning.
